Efficient and stable catalysis of hollow Cu9S5 nanospheres in the Fenton-like degradation of organic dyes

TL;DR: Hollow Cu9S5 nanospheres can effectively accelerate the decomposition of H2O2 into hydroxyl radicals and superoxide radical, which have been proven to be mainly oxidative species in the Fenton-like degradation of organic pollutants.

Microwave synthesis of hierarchical porous materials with various structures by controllable desilication and recrystallization

TL;DR: In this paper, a hierarchical porous material with controllable structures is synthesized through a one-step approach by adjusting the detemplation degree of the parent zeolites, which provides an opening framework in ZSM-5 for subsequent desilication in alkaline solution by microwave digestion.

ZSM-5@MCM-41 composite porous materials with a core-shell structure: Adjustment of mesoporous orientation basing on interfacial electrostatic interactions and their application in selective aromatics transport

TL;DR: In this paper, a series of hierarchically porous materials with core-shell structures have been successfully fabricated through a modified Stober method, where the interfacial growth of mesoporous silica with adjustable mesochannel orientation on the surface of ZSM-5 nanocrystal results in the formation of a coreshell structure.
